What is a Junior Node Js Developer job?

A Junior Node.js Developer is an entry-level software developer who specializes in building and maintaining server-side applications using Node.js. They typically work on backend logic, database interactions, and API integrations, often under the guidance of senior developers. Their responsibilities may include writing clean and efficient code, debugging applications, and collaborating with frontend developers to create seamless applications. This role is ideal for those with a basic understanding of JavaScript, Node.js frameworks like Express.js, and database management. Junior Node.js Developers often grow into more advanced backend roles with experience and skill development.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Junior Node Js Developer position, and why are they important?

As a Junior Node Js Developer, you should possess a basic understanding of JavaScript, Node.js, and fundamental web development concepts, typically supported by a degree in computer science or relevant coursework.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, package managers such as npm, and RESTful API integration is highly beneficial. Strong problem-solving abilities, eagerness to learn, and effective teamwork skills will help you excel in this position. These skills are crucial for building reliable web applications, collaborating on projects, and adapting to rapidly evolving development environments.

What does a typical day look like for a Junior Node Js Developer?

A typical day for a Junior Node Js Developer involves writing and testing server-side code, fixing bugs, and collaborating with other developers to implement new features or improve existing ones. You’ll likely participate in daily standup meetings, review code through pull requests, and communicate with front-end developers or database administrators to ensure seamless integration of application components. Often, you’ll receive guidance and feedback from senior developers or team leads as you grow your skillset. This hands-on environment helps you gain practical experience while working on meaningful projects within a supportive team structure.
